Interview with Ligia de Wit, Author of Touch of Faete


master mentalism tricks

What’s the story behind the story? What inspired you to write Touch of Faete (Bradaís Pledge Book 1)?

Ryanne and Bricius woke me up at 6 a.m. on a Sunday a few years back. They wouldn’t let me go back to sleep, until I agreed to write them. Then I pictured Titus walking inside a coffee shop, and from there I didn’t stop until I finished that first version. I didn’t have a say in it. As a child, I read fairy tales, and as I grew up, those fairy tales gave way to pirate stories, those who fought in the Caribbean against English colonies, and even one who fought in Malaysian waters. I loved them with a passion, and it felt just natural to blend both.

If you had to pick theme songs for the main characters of Touch of Faete (Bradaís Pledge Book 1), what would they be?

Demons by Imagine Dragons for my antagonist-turned-reluctant-antihero. It hits too close to home!

What’s your favorite genre to read? Is it the same as your favorite genre to write?

Fantasy in every form. I tend to write Contemporary Fantasy, but I’m open to all!

What books are on your TBR pile right now?

Uf! How many can I put here? Just off the top of my head, “A Gathering of Chromes”, and “The Undying man”.

What scene in your book was your favorite to write?

Tough one! It might have been one near the ending but I can’t tell because, spoiler. Let’s say it involves the sea.

Do you have any quirky writing habits? (lucky mugs, cats on laps, etc.)

Not really, I write whenever I can since I’m always surrounded by noise.

Do you have a motto, quote, or philosophy you live by?

Be open to learning. You never stop.

If you could choose one thing for readers to remember after reading your book, what would it be?

There’s more to Titus’s backstory than what you read. A lot more.
